    A nurse in an emergency department is assessing an adolescent who reports inhalation of gasoline. Which of the following findings should the nurse expect?

    Explanation & Rationale

    Gasoline inhalation is a form of hydrocarbon abuse commonly associated with inhalant use in adolescents. These substances rapidly affect the central nervous system because they are highly lipid-soluble and quickly cross the blood-brain barrier. Acute intoxication produces CNS depression similar to alcohol intoxication, leading to impaired coordination, dizziness, confusion, and slurred speech. Early recognition is important because severe exposure can also cause respiratory depression and cardiac dysrhythmias. Rationale: A. Pinpoint pupils are more commonly associated with opioid intoxication rather than hydrocarbon inhalation. Gasoline inhalation primarily causes central nervous system depression and neurologic impairment rather than the parasympathetic pupillary constriction seen with narcotic overdose. Therefore, this is not the expected finding. B. Hyperactive reflexes are not typical of gasoline inhalation because hydrocarbons usually depress the central nervous system rather than stimulate it. Clients are more likely to present with slowed responses, dizziness, and decreased coordination instead of exaggerated reflex activity. CNS depression is the more characteristic effect. C. Ataxia is expected because gasoline inhalation causes CNS depression that affects balance, coordination, and motor control. Adolescents may appear unsteady, stagger while walking, and have slurred speech similar to alcohol intoxication. This neurologic impairment is a common sign of inhalant abuse and should raise concern for hydrocarbon exposure. D. Hypothermia is not the primary expected finding with gasoline inhalation. Although environmental exposure may influence body temperature, the major acute effects involve neurologic depression, dizziness, and impaired coordination. Temperature changes are less characteristic than ataxia in this type of intoxication.
